Picking the ideal chapter for small businesses in Nevada

When a Las Vegas Bankruptcy Attorney measure a case, the very first fork is whether to reorganize business or wind it down. The 2nd is whether the primary danger sits with the business or with the owner through assurances and tax assessments.

Chapter 7 for organizations looks like a terminal occasion. The company stops operating, a trustee gathers non-exempt properties, and financial institutions receive whatever circulation the estate can fund. Chapter 7 for people, however, can release assurance exposure if there is no scams or top priority barrier. A Chapter 7 Bankruptcy Attorney will look for clean books, minimal recent transfers, and limited non-exempt personal properties. If a downtown store is closing and the owner's home equity is protected by Nevada's homestead exemption, personal Chapter 7 can be a powerful reset.

Chapter 13 is individual reorganization. It does not apply to entities, however it can save an owner captured by individual warranties, current tax financial obligation, or a judgment from a Strip mall landlord. A capable Chapter 13 Bankruptcy Attorney builds a strategy that extends arrears over 3 to five years and channels non reusable earnings based upon IRS requirements and real expenses. I have used Chapter 13 to keep a delivery van in service for a sole proprietor in North Las Vegas while dealing with a lawsuit connected to a shuttered kiosk at Wonder Mile Shops.

For companies that ought to continue, Chapter 11 Subchapter V is frequently underappreciated. It streamlines the reorganization procedure for small business debtors and strips away some of the most pricey portions of standard Chapter 11. Strategy confirmation can happen with fewer financial institution votes if the strategy is possible and fair. I have actually seen a pair of franchise gyms near Centennial Hills bring equipment loans and lease arrears into Subchapter V, keep doors open, and emerge leaner by rejecting one lease, renegotiating another, and refinancing through a plan-backed note. It is not low-cost, however compared with full Chapter 11, it is available for Nevada companies with incomes that swing seasonally.

The automated stay and what it does not do

The automatic stay stops suits, collections, garnishments, and a lot of foreclosures the moment you file. It relaxes the phone and freezes the spiral. Landlords in locations like The District at Green Valley Cattle ranch must stop briefly expulsion if lease is tied to prepetition quantities. Lenders can not swoop in on a box truck or a combi-oven without court relief. Still, the stay is a shield, not an income stream. You need to pay brand-new rent as it comes due after filing. You need to keep energies present. You need to make sufficient security payments on collateral or face relief from the stay.

The day after filing, vendors will search for assurance. A good Bankruptcy Attorney Las Vegas citizens trust will prepare vendor letters that describe the case, assure suppliers about post-petition commitments, and welcome interim terms. These letters do not guarantee cooperation, yet they typically avoid a blunt COD rule from disrupting operations. I once watched a bakeshop on Rainbow stay equipped because we provided a purchase order and paid upon shipment while the strategy developed, rather than argue about unsecured prepetition balances that the strategy would manage later.

Rent, leases, and the Strip effect

Commercial leases in Las Vegas can be punishing, particularly in high-footfall locations like the Strip, Town Square, and Tivoli Town. Percentage rent clauses, camera reconciliations, and demolition provisions complicate analysis. In Chapter 11, a debtor needs to choose to presume or reject a lease within statutory limitations, which the court can extend for cause. If a location pays, presumption plus cure of defaults can preserve it. If the area is a drag, rejection permits an exit with the proprietor holding an unsecured claim topic to caps. Timing matters. Treatment payments need genuine money or plan treatment. Waiting too long to submit can put the lease out of reach if the property manager has actually currently terminated it under Nevada law.

Personal assurances connected to the lease magnify danger. Even if a service files Chapter 11, the owner might require individual relief under Chapter 13 or Chapter 7 to handle the assurance. Coordination in between the company case and the specific case avoids clashing responsibilities. I have actually matched a Subchapter V for a restaurant in the Southwest Valley with an individual Chapter 13 for the owner so the business could assume one lease, turn down another, and the owner could pay the capped claim from the rejected lease through a manageable plan.

Dealing with merchant cash advances, equipment loans, and UCC liens

Many Las Vegas services used MCAs throughout the post-pandemic rebound. These agreements are not loans on paper, yet they often operate like high-rate funding. Daily or weekly pulls from the merchant processor drain liquidity. In insolvency, some MCA funders argue for relief from stay to keep pulling. Others declare a security interest in receivables under a UCC filing. A skilled Las Vegas Bankruptcy Attorney will examine the arrangement language, the UCC status, and the circulation of funds. Sometimes, we recharacterize the plan or negotiate a structured decrease under a strategy. Evidence helps. Show the daily pulls, charge stacks, and effective APR. I have actually lowered a $180,000 stack to $65,000 plan treatment when the records made the economics undeniable.

Equipment loans secured by kitchen area equipment, lifts, or print presses are more uncomplicated. You value the collateral and propose appropriate protection or cramdown depending upon chapter. If a Henderson print shop's press appraises at $40,000 and the note claims $85,000, plan treatment can pay the secured part with interest and push the rest into unsecured claims. Prepare for lenders to challenge appraisal. Good pictures, current invoices, maintenance logs, and an independent appraiser who comprehends use hours bring weight.

Taxes and trust-fund exposure

Sales tax and payroll trust-fund withholding produce personal exposure in Nevada. If your bar in the Arts District fell behind on sales tax, insolvency will not just remove those amounts. Concern status typically requires full payment over the strategy term with interest. In https://anotepad.com/notes/grpe7qf7 Chapter 13, that is possible if capital allows it. In Chapter 11, the strategy should show feasibility, and the IRS or Nevada Department of Taxation will push for prompt treatment. Always reconcile returns before filing. A submitted case with unfiled returns is a grenade without a pin. I have actually postponed cases by 2 or three weeks to prepare missing out on sales tax filings, which avoided early motions from tax authorities that can hinder a strategy narrative.

When unwinding is the wise play

Not every service need to survive. A retail concept near the Strat that counts on trip bus traffic can not unexpectedly pivot to e‑commerce without capital and time. When the best relocation is a dignified wind-down, do it with a plan. Sell disposable inventory quick for reasonable value. Return consigned items. Work out key-holder money with the property owner if you can deliver a tidy shop quickly. An individual Chapter 7 might clear guarantees if your properties are secured and current transfers are clean. If you require to keep tools of the trade for your next chapter as a sole owner, Nevada exemptions cover a modest amount of equipment. Align the wind-down with your individual filing so you do not invite choice or deceptive transfer issues.

Proof of funds, cash security, and the very first 30 days

In reorganizations, the very first month sets reliability with the court and creditors. If you depend on cash collateral, such as receivables topic to a loan provider's lien, you require permission or a court order to utilize that money. Submit a comprehensive budget. Show how rent on a storage facility off Sunset, payroll for five staff members, and vendor drops suit the numbers. If predicted profits depends on a big weekend throughout a Raiders home game at Allegiant Arena, say so and back it with prior-year merchant data from comparable weekends. Uniqueness soothes objections. A judge in Nevada will appreciate numbers pegged to regional events more than wishful thinking.

Personal possession security for owners with guarantees

Nevada's homestead exemption is generous compared to numerous states, which often permits an owner to clear guarantees through Chapter 7 without losing the primary house, assuming equity falls within limitations and other risk factors do not use. Retirement accounts often stay protected. Automobiles and tools have caps. The analysis is fact driven. If you have a 2nd home near Lake Las Vegas or a financial investment apartment by Downtown Summerlin, anticipate examination and potential liquidation or plan treatment. Plan your timing if a re-finance might trap equity, and never move assets to loved ones in the run-up to filing. Trustees in Nevada are diligent, and avoidable transfers can sink a case or claw back funds.

Out of‑court workouts and projects for the advantage of creditors

Bankruptcy is a tool, not a religion. Some companies deal with financial obligation through forbearance arrangements, interest reductions, or extension of terms without filing. Objective leverage helps. If a loan provider understands you could file Chapter 11 Subchapter V next week and cut its position, a smart exercise becomes more likely. Nevada also acknowledges tasks for the advantage of lenders, a state law mechanism to liquidate orderly. It can be much faster than Chapter 7, however it does not have the extensive stay and discharge. Utilize it when financial institution cooperation is high and properties are straightforward.
